Quick description about triangula:
Generate high-quality triangulated and polygonal art from images. Triangula uses a modified genetic algorithm to triangulate or polygonate images. It works best with images smaller than 3000px and with fewer than 3000 points, typically producing an optimal result within a couple of minutes. For a full explanation of the algorithm, see this page in the wiki. You can try the algorithm out in your browser, but the desktop app will typically be 20-50x faster. If the app isn't running on Linux, go to the Permissions tab in the executable's properties and tick `Allow executing file as program`. For almost all cases, only changing the number of points and leaving all other options with their default values will generate an optimal result. While all these algorithms are iterative algorithms, the main difference is that in the other algorithms triangles can overlap while Triangula generates a triangulation.Features:
